Chiralyst® Ru636

Chiralyst® Ru636

[((R,R)-2-Amino-1,2-diphenylethyl)[(4-tolyl)sulfonyl]amido](chloro)(p-cymene)ruthenium(II)

CAS Number: 192139-92-7

Chemical properties

Chemical formula

C31H35N2ClO2SRu

Empirical formula

Ru[(R,R)-TsDPEN](p-cymene)Cl

Molecular weight

636.22

Metal

Ru

Theoretical metal content

16

Physical state

powder

Color

orange

Metal purity

99.9

Applications & references

Description

Synthesis of optically active 4-hydroxy-2,6,6-trimethyl-cyclohex-3-enone derivatives via enantioselective transfer hydrogenation of the corresponding enolethers for the production of (3S,3’S)-astaxantin.

Reference: WO2008 116714

 

Asymmetric transfer hydrogenation of functionalized ketones for the drug substance synthesis, e.g. rivastigimine for the treatment of Alzheimer’s disease.

Reference: WO2010 0072798

 

Preparation of optically active aromatic epoxides by asymmetric transfer hydrogenation of α-chlorinated ketones.  

Reference: Tetrah. 2004, 60, 7411 (DOI: 10.1016/j.tet.2004.06.076)

 

Asymmetric transfer hydrogenation of benzyl with formic acid.

Reference: Org. Lett. 1999, 1, 1119 (DOI: 10.1021/ol990226a)
